Tablo’s Preview App Update Adds Conflict Resolution, Manual Recording

TabloThis week, Tablo announced an update to its Tablo Preview app that adds support for conflict resolution, manual programs, and other features. The app is available on Amazon’s Fire TV line as well as Android TV devices and this latest update brings Tablo Preview up to version 1.8.0

In a forum posting earlier this week, the company listed what users could expect once they receive the update. One of the clear headliners among those additions is support for conflict resolution, where users can review and address potential scheduling overlaps with different recordings. The new manual recording feature, unsurprisingly, allows users to set up recordings manually with options for scheduling frequency, days of the week, retention time, and more.

Tablo says it plans on monitoring how the new conflict resolution feature performs on the Preview app, adding that it may bring the feature to other platforms in the future.
